22ret with blow by?
1986 extra cab pickup. compression is 145 on each cyl, i replaced the pcv valve to. its not to much blow by but enough to make it leak. i have replaced EVERY gasket and seal on this motor. rear main, oil pan, timing chain cover, cover gaskets, front main, valve cover and half moon things. i dont understand how im getting blow by with 145 psi! im wondering if there is something im missing? ive changed plugs, wires cap and rotor to. i know the turbo probly has bad seals cause it smokes and there is a lil oil in the turbo / intake tube. i have done alot of other work to the truck like turned it into 4x4,sas, elocker rear ect so i dont want to didtch the project. if i have to do rings i will but if any one has had this problem or fixed it some how or even have an idea let me know! thanks.

id check your oil drain galleries in the head, thats how the blow-by gases are supposed to rise up and go through the PCV. if they are clogged or slightly clogged the oil trying to run back down to the pan will go but it wont let the gases rise.
